[and also the] length [of the ‛ūd] will probably be: thirty-6 joint fingers—with superior thick fingers—and the overall will total to a few ashbār.[Notes one] And its width: fifteen fingers. And its depth seven as well as a fifty percent fingers. And also the measurement from the width from the bridge with the rest guiding: six fingers. Remains the duration of your strings: 30 fingers and on these strings take place the division and the partition, mainly because it could be the sounding [or "the speaking"] duration.

Musicologist Richard Dumbrill these days makes use of the word a lot more categorically to discuss instruments that existed millennia before the term "lute" was coined.[26] Dumbrill documented greater than 3000 several years of iconographic proof to the lutes in Mesopotamia, in his ebook The Archaeomusicology of the Ancient Close to East. In accordance with Dumbrill, the lute household provided devices in Mesopotamia previous to 3000 BC.[27] He factors to some cylinder seal as evidence; relationship from c. 3100 BC or before (now while in the possession in the British Museum); the seal depicts on one facet what on earth is regarded as a woman playing a adhere "lute".

Arabian ouds are Generally more substantial than their Turkish and Persian counterparts, producing a fuller, further sound, While the audio in the Turkish oud is much more taut and shrill, not the very least since the Turkish oud is usually (and partly) tuned a single entire move increased when compared to the Arabian.[fifty four] Turkish ouds are generally much official music charts more evenly constructed than Arabian having an unfinished audio board, reduced string motion and with string programs positioned nearer alongside one another.
